The Pittsburgh Penguins have recalled forward Jayson Megna from AHL Wilkes-Barre/Scranton, the club announced on Thursday.

Megna, 24, is with the big club for depth purposes but could draw into tonight’s game against the defending Stanley Cup champion Kings, as Pittsburgh head coach Mike Johnston spoke favorably about his performance thus far:

A one-year standout at the University of Nebraska-Omaha, Megna signed with Pittsburgh in 2012 and made his NHL debut last season, scoring five goals and nine points in 36 games for the Penguins.
